Jersey City Medical Center yesterday announced the opening of a satellite at Exchange Place that will offer primary care and specialty and rehabilitation services.

Located at 95 Greene St., the branch will ā€œbring care closer to where people live, right in their communities,ā€œ according to a spokesman for RWJ Barnabas Health, the centerā€™s corporate parent. 

Mayor Fulop, who was on hand for the July 6 ribbon cutting, said the city is “proud to partner with the Jersey City Medical Center in bringing these essential services to our community.ā€

All appointments must be pre-scheduled. Visits for primary or specialty care can be arranged by calling 201-499-8730. Those needing outpatient rehabilitation services, such as physical or occupational therapy, should call 201-499-8700. Those seeking speech therapy or audiology services, should dial 201-499-8720.
